Do Eyelash Extensions Ruin Your Natural Lashes?

Eyelash extensions can be a great way to enhance your look and give you the confidence boost you need. However, if they are too heavy for your natural lashes to support, this can cause them to fall out prematurely and affect their natural growth cycle. This can lead to your lashes becoming thinner than before you put on the extensions. It is important to practice proper aftercare in order to keep your lashes healthy and prolong the time between fillers.

If not cleaned properly, microscopic mites can cause inflammation and itching in the eyes. Like the hair on your head, eyelashes can get greasy if not washed. Each eyelash extension is connected to a natural eyelash, so extensions fall out in the same cycle as natural lashes. You can assure customers that their eyelashes will continue to grow even with the extensions on.

If you are a customer, express any allergies or sensitivities to your technician from the start. Having irritated eyes can cause a lot of rubbing and pulling, which could damage your natural lashes.
